A poundal is a unit of force used primarily in the foot-pound-second (FPS) system of units. It is defined as the force necessary to accelerate a one-pound mass at a rate of one foot per second squared. While not as commonly used today, the poundal provides a historical perspective on force measurement in contexts that utilize the FPS system. Understanding its definition helps bridge the gap between different systems of measurement and offers insight into the evolution of physical units over time.
Definition of KilopoiseKilopoise is a unit of dynamic viscosity in the centimeter-gram-second (CGS) system of units. One kilopoise equals 1,000 poise, which is the viscosity of a fluid in which a force of one dyne per square centimeter maintains a velocity difference of one centimeter per second between parallel layers one centimeter apart. This unit is crucial in fields like fluid dynamics and material science, where understanding the internal friction of a fluid is essential. By quantifying viscosity, scientists and engineers can predict how fluids will behave under various conditions.
Poundal Second/Square Foot (pdl·s/ft²) | Kilopoise (kP) |
---|---|
0.01 pdl·s/ft² | 0.0004788 kP |
0.1 pdl·s/ft² | 0.004788 kP |
1 pdl·s/ft² | 0.04788 kP |
10 pdl·s/ft² | 0.4788 kP |
20 pdl·s/ft² | 0.9576 kP |
50 pdl·s/ft² | 2.394 kP |
100 pdl·s/ft² | 4.788 kP |
200 pdl·s/ft² | 9.576 kP |
500 pdl·s/ft² | 23.94 kP |
1000 pdl·s/ft² | 47.88 kP |
1 pdl·s/ft² = 0.04788 kP
1 kP = 20.88 pdl·s/ft²
Example 1:
convert 5 pdl·s/ft² to kP:
5 pdl·s/ft² = 5 × 0.04788 kP = 0.2394 kP
Example 2:
convert 3.5 pdl·s/ft² to kP:
3.5 pdl·s/ft² = 3.5 × 0.04788 kP = 0.16758 kP
